ABSTRACT

Objective@#To study the effects of miR-497 and CDK6 on the growth of laryngeal squamous cell carcinoma (LSCC).@*Methods@#The expressions of CDK6 mRNA in fresh LSCC specimens, the adjacent normal mucosa of LSCC, and cell lines of LSCC were detected with quantitative real time polymerase chain reaction, pcDNA3.1(+) CDK6 plasmids were respectively transfected into the LSCC cells, and MTT assay and clone formation assay were performed to evaluate the growth of LSCC cells. Flow cytometry was employed for cell cycle analysis. SPSS17.0 software was used to analyze the data.@*Results@#CDK6 was highly expressed in LSCC(t=14.01, P=0.009) and the overall survival rate of the patients with high CDK6 expression was less than that with low CDK6 expression, with a significant difference (HR=3.236, P<0.001). Double luciferase reporter gene analysis showed that fluorescence activity in wild type CDK6 group was significantly different from that in control group (P<0.01), while there was no significant difference in the fluorescence activity between mutant CDK6 group and control group (P>0.05). A490 values were respectively 0.42±0.14 (Mean±SD) in siRNA Hep-2 group, 0.51±0.13 in siRNA TU-212 group; 0.98±0.16 in control Hep-2 group and 1.17±0.20 in control TU-212 group. Colonies were 55±4 in siRNA Hep-2 group, 51±3 in siRNA TU-212 group, 108±6 in control Hep-2 group and 105±7 in control TU-212 group, namely, cell growth and clone formation ability in CDK6 siRNA group were significantly lower than those in the control group. Cells cycle was blocked in G0/G1 phase (G0/G1: 65.20%±10.12% in siRNA Hep-2 group; 63.42%±8.97% in siRNA TU-212 group; 45.31%±7.55% in control Hep-2 group; and 42.37%±7.28% in control TU-212 group), and cells decreased obviously in S phase (S: 25.39%±5.51% in siRNA Hep-2 group; 27.21%±5.43% in siRNA TU-212 group; 42.87%±6.85% in control Hep-2 group; and 44.76%±7.02% in control TU-212 group). Compared with miR-497 group, cell growth and clone formation ability in miR-497/CDK6 group were partly restored (all P<0.05).@*Conclusions@#CDK6 expression in LSCC is upregulated, functioning as an oncogene. High expression of CDK6 is a predictor for poor prognosis. miR-497, functioning as a tumor suppressor gene, inhibits the growth of LSCC by targeting CDK6.

ABSTRACT

Objective@#To study the roles of miR-497 and PlexinA4 in the progression of laryngeal squamous cell carcinoma.@*Methods@#The expressions of miR-497 and PlexinA4 in fresh tumor specimens and adjacent normal mucosa tissues as well as in cell lines of laryngeal squamous cell carcinoma (LSCC) were detected with qRT-PCR and immunohistochemistry. The association of miR-497 and PlexinA4 expressions with clinicopathologic factors and their prognostic values in LSCC were evaluated PlexinA4 siRNA and pcDNA3.1 (+ )/PlexinA4 plasmid were transfected into the LSCC and measured by Transwell to evaluate their effect on the invasion of LSCC.@*Results@#miR-497 was low expression in LSCC, which related to pathological differentiation, while PlexinA4 mRNA was high expression in LSCC. Kaplan-Meier method showed that the prognosis of patients with high miR-497 expression was better than that of patients with low miR-497 expression (χ2=10.342, P=0.001); . Cox regression analysis showed that miR-497 was an independent prognostic factor for LSCC. The double luciferase reporter gene showed that the variation of the fluorescence activity of wild type PlexinA4 was significantly different from that of the control group (P<0.01). In Hep-2 and TU212 cell line, the number of cells with PlexinA4 siRNA passing through the compartments was 70.00±10.85 and 85.00±6.45, significantly higher than control (F values were 30.251 and 23.936, both P<0.05), the number of cells with pcDNA3.1 (+ ) /PlexinA4 was 170.56±11.95 and 142.00±10.43, also significantly less than control (F values were 35.104 and 29.643, both P<0.05).@*Conclusion@#The expression of miR-497 in LSCC is decreased, indicating poor prognosis, which is as an independent risk factor for prognosis of LSCC. miR-497 may modulate LSCC invasion through PlexinA4.

ABSTRACT

Objective To evaluate the effects of phonosurgery combined with voice therapy in patients with vocal polyps accompanied with muscle tension dysphonia (MTD) .Methods The study retrospectively enrolled 117 patients with a diagnosis of vocal polyps accompanied with MTD .All the patients were divided into two groups ac‐cording to the different remedies:the surgery group (n=57) ,and the combination group (n=60) .The Xion acous‐tic analysis was carried out on the two groups before and after therapy .We compared the results in each group ,the results of post-therapy between two groups ,and that of post-therapy with the control group(n=50) .The acous‐tic parameters were jitter percent (jitter) ,shimmer percent (shimmer) ,dysphonia severity index (DSI) .Results The results obtained in the study showed that all the voice analysis parameters were significantly improved after therapy in both the surgery group and combination group(P0 .05) .Conclusion As for vocal polyps accompanied with M TD ,successful phonosurgical treatment and voice therapy can improve patients’ voice quality .

ABSTRACT

Objective To study the influence of UPPP on resonance characteristics of four resonance cavity in patients with OSAHS .Methods Using multi-channel voice analysis system to test the cavity resonance character-istics and energy distribution of 36 OSAHS patients (including pre - and post -operative) and 36 normal males when they speak /a:/.The frequency spectrum was 4 000Hz(FR1 ,FR2 ,FR3 ,FR4 ) .Results FR2 energy values of the head cavity and mouth cavity of OSAHS patients heighten significantly after UPPP (P<0 .05);FR1 energy val-ues of head ,mouth and thoracic cavity were higher than that of in normal males'after UPPP(P<0 .05) .FR2 ,FR3 , FR4 energy values of head cavity ,FR2 ,FR3 energy values of mouth cavity ,FR2 energy values of thoracic cavity were lower than those of in normal males'after UPPP(P<0 .05) .Conclusion UPPP surgery removes the obstruction of the upper airway of OSAHS patients and changes the morphology of the pharynx ,thas changes the resonance charac-teristics of the head cavity and oral .

ABSTRACT

Objective To evaluate the midterm efficacy of prosthetic disc nucleus ( PDN) replacement for the treatment of lumbar disc herniation. Methods Twenty cases of lumbar disc herniation( including one case of recurrent lumbar disc herniation) were treated with PDN. The twenty cases were followed-up 5.4 ~6.2 years( mean 5.7 years). Functional,and radiographic follow-up examinations,MRI and follow-up records of all patients were reviewed carefully. Results Clinical evaluation at the end of follow-up,there were 10 cases in excellent,6 cases in good,2 cases in fair and 2 cases in poor,and good rate was 80%. One patient accepted the revision operation to remove the PDN because of device migration. One patient accepted the fusion because of adjacent segment disease. The others experienced pain relief, and resumed their normal life and work. The average Oswestry score and VAS get better significantly. Conclusion The PDN was effective in treating patients with lumbar disc herniation. However, the medium term complications of device subsidence should be taken seriously.
